I want to burn a DVD in NTSC.

Here where I live we use PAL, but it is for my folks in hte USA.

Where is the setting?

Is it during the creation of the ISO file?

Or during the burning of the disk?

Posted

ImgBurn doesnt do anything to TV formats, all it does is burn what you give it to burn.

You'd need to change the TV format with some other software
